四川女子花62万买彩票 仅中奖一注(因为工作人员打错号码)# Joke - 肚皮舞运动
j*2
1 楼
1. Print all paths of a binary tree
How to do it iteratively? 用一个stack实现preorder来做?
2. Given an array of integers, find any 3 numbers in array such that they
sum to zero. eg:
[1, 2, -3, 4, 0]
1) 1 , 2, -3
2) 0, 0, 0
这个是不是三重循环?还有更快的吗?
3. 一个数组,一个target,求所有的pairs, array[i] - array[j] = k.
hash table? 要是k=0, 所有数都相等呢?怎么看都是n^2了
4. 一个字符串,一个字符数组,求所有的子字符串,子字符串不能包括字符数组里面的所
有元素.
abbc, [a,b,c] -> a, b, c, ab, abb, bbc, bb, bc
有什么好思路?
5.多层链表压扁及还原
我用stack写了一下,面试写起来太麻烦。哪位大牛给个简洁的recursion版本?
谢谢!
How to do it iteratively? 用一个stack实现preorder来做?
2. Given an array of integers, find any 3 numbers in array such that they
sum to zero. eg:
[1, 2, -3, 4, 0]
1) 1 , 2, -3
2) 0, 0, 0
这个是不是三重循环?还有更快的吗?
3. 一个数组,一个target,求所有的pairs, array[i] - array[j] = k.
hash table? 要是k=0, 所有数都相等呢?怎么看都是n^2了
4. 一个字符串,一个字符数组,求所有的子字符串,子字符串不能包括字符数组里面的所
有元素.
abbc, [a,b,c] -> a, b, c, ab, abb, bbc, bb, bc
有什么好思路?
5.多层链表压扁及还原
我用stack写了一下,面试写起来太麻烦。哪位大牛给个简洁的recursion版本?
谢谢!